首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过调用函数并向其传递字符串来添加我刚刚删除的选项卡

通过调用函数并向其传递字符串来添加刚刚删除的选项卡,可以使用以下步骤:

  1. 首先,需要定义一个函数,该函数用于添加选项卡。函数可以接受一个字符串参数,表示要添加的选项卡的名称。
  2. 在函数内部,可以使用前端开发技术(如HTML、CSS和JavaScript)来创建一个新的选项卡元素,并设置其名称为传递的字符串参数。
  3. 接下来,可以将新创建的选项卡元素添加到选项卡容器中。选项卡容器可以是一个HTML元素,例如一个div或ul。
  4. 最后,可以在需要添加选项卡的地方调用该函数,并传递要添加的选项卡的名称作为字符串参数。

这样,通过调用函数并向其传递字符串,就可以实现添加刚刚删除的选项卡的功能。

以下是一个示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>添加选项卡</title>
  <style>
    /* 样式可以根据需求进行自定义 */
    .tab {
      display: inline-block;
      padding: 10px;
      background-color: #f2f2f2;
      border: 1px solid #ccc;
      cursor: pointer;
    }
  </style>
</head>
<body>
  <div id="tabContainer">
    <!-- 已存在的选项卡 -->
    <div class="tab">选项卡1</div>
    <div class="tab">选项卡2</div>
    <div class="tab">选项卡3</div>
  </div>

  <script>
    function addTab(tabName) {
      // 创建新的选项卡元素
      var newTab = document.createElement("div");
      newTab.className = "tab";
      newTab.textContent = tabName;

      // 将新选项卡添加到容器中
      var tabContainer = document.getElementById("tabContainer");
      tabContainer.appendChild(newTab);
    }

    // 调用函数并传递要添加的选项卡名称
    addTab("刚刚删除的选项卡");
  </script>
</body>
</html>

在上述示例中,通过调用addTab函数并传递字符串参数"刚刚删除的选项卡",可以将一个新的选项卡添加到已存在的选项卡容器中。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

快速学习-在 Remix 上构建简单水龙头合约

属性 sender 是交易发件人地址。函数传递是一个内置函数,它将以太从合约传递调用地址。向后读,这意味着转移到触发此合约执行 msg 发送者。传递函数将金额作为唯一参数。...打开 MetaMask,并向发送 1 个以太,就像你发送给其他任何以太坊地址一样: ? ?...要提现,我们必须构造一个调用 withdraw函数交易,并将 withdraw_amount 参数传递给它。...运行水龙头合约提现功能时,首先它调用 require 函数并验证我们金额小 于或等于允许最大提现 0.1 以太;然后它调用传递函数向我们发送以太,运行转账功能会产生一个内部交易,从合约余额中将...最后,我们构建了一个交易调用 withdraw 函数并成功请求 0.1 ether。合约检查了我们请求,并通过内部交易向我们发送了 0.1 以太。

1.8K20

关于“Python”核心知识点整理大全15

7.3.2 删除包含特定值所有列表元素 在第3章中,我们使用函数remove()删除列表中特定值,这之所以可行,是因为要删除 值在列表中只出现了一次。...这 个函数接受你传递给它名字,并向这个人发出问候: Hello, Jesse!...同样,greet_user('sarah')调用函数greet_user()并向传递'sarah',打印Hello, Sarah!。...向函数传递实参 方式很多,可使用位置实参,这要求实参顺序与形参顺序相同;也可使用关键字实参, 中每个实参都由变量名和值组成;还可使用列表和字典。下面依次介绍这些方式。...调用函数多次是一种效率极高工作方式。我们只需在函数中编写描述宠物代码一次,然 后每当需要描述新宠物时,都可调用这个函数并向它提供新宠物信息。

12210
  • 接口测试工具 Postman 使用实践

    API 接口定义:对协议进行定义引用类型。 好多公司开发人员分前后端,他们之间如何配合工作,就是其中一方定义接口,另一方调用接口,以实现预期功能。 二、接口分类 1....API 接口走 HTTP 协议,通过路径区分调用方法,请求报文入参有多种形式,返回报文一般为 json 串,最常见是 get 和 post 方法。...侧边栏分为两个主要选项卡,包括历史和集合选项卡。可以拖动右边调整侧边栏宽度。侧边栏也可以隐藏到小屏幕(标题栏 view—>toggle side bar)。...(1)历史选项卡 通过 Postman 应用程序发送每个请求都保存在侧边栏 History 选项卡中。 (2)集合选项卡 在侧栏中创建和管理集合选项卡集合。 2....GET 请求可以使用 “查询字符串参数” 将参数传递给服务器。例如,在下列请求中,http://example.com/hi/there?

    1.4K20

    接口测试工具Postman使用实践

    好多公司开发人员分前后端,他们之间如何配合工作,就是其中一方定义接口,另一方调用接口,以实现预期功能。...工具进行测试; HTTP API接口走HTTP协议,通过路径区分调用方法,请求报文入参有多种形式,返回报文一般为json串,最常见是get和post方法。...侧边栏分为两个主要选项卡,包括历史和集合选项卡。 可以拖动右边调整侧边栏宽度。侧边栏也可以隐藏到小屏幕(标题栏 view—>toggle side bar)。...(1)历史选项卡 通过Postman应用程序发送每个请求都保存在侧边栏History选项卡中。 (2)集合选项卡 在侧栏中创建和管理集合选项卡集合。...GET请求可以使用“查询字符串参数”将参数传递给服务器。例如,在下列请求中,http://example.com/hi/there?hand=wave,参数“hand”值等于“wave”。

    1.4K40

    浅析JDBC常用类和接口——JDBCDriver接口、DriverManager类、Connection接口

    二、Driver接口 1.在JDBC中,每个驱动程序一般会提供一个实现Dirver接口类。当你在加载某一个Driver类,它自己实例化并向DriverManager注册这个实例。...这就是意味着用户可以使用Class.forName()方法调用程序加载和注册一个驱动程序。...static void main(String[] args) { //定义一个字符串保存com.mysql.jdbcDriver类路径 String...在上面代码中,首先是声明一个字符串保存com.mysql.jdbcDriver类路径,使用Class.forName()方法加载这个驱动,方便后续数据库连接。...文中介绍使用Class.forName()方法调用程序加载和注册一个驱动程序具体过程,还介绍了它常用方法。

    1.7K40

    Python 自动化指南(繁琐工作自动化)第二版:十五、使用 PDF 和 WORD 文档

    您可以通过调用PdfFileReader对象上getPage()方法 ➋ 并向传递您感兴趣页面的页码(在我们示例中为 0)获得Page对象。...这就是为什么我们例子用一个新PdfFileReader对象重新打开文件。 要读取加密 PDF,调用decrypt()函数并以字符串形式传递密码。...write()方法保存到文件之前,调用encrypt()方法,并向传递一个密码字符串 ➊。...创建 Word 文档 你可以用新段落文本再次调用add_paragraph()方法添加段落。或者将文本添加到现有段落末尾,您可以调用该段落add_run()方法并向传递一个字符串。...练习题 PDF 文件名字符串值是传递给PyPDF2.PdfFileReader()函数吗。你传递函数是什么呢?

    3.6K50

    Pandas profiling 生成报告并部署一站式解决方案

    可以将DataFrame对象传递给profiling函数,然后调用创建函数对象以开始生成分析文件。 无论采用哪种方式,都将获得相同输出报告。我正在使用第二种方法为导入农业数据集生成报告。...它还会报告与变量相关任何警告,而不管数据类型如何 切换按钮扩展到Overview, Categories, Words, and Characters选项卡。...字符串类型值概览选项卡显示最大-最小中值平均长度、总字符、不同字符、不同类别、唯一和来自数据集样本。 类别选项卡显示直方图,有时显示特征值计数饼图。该表包含值、计数和百分比频率。...报告所有元素都是自动选择,默认值是首选。 报告中可能有一些您不想包含元素,或者您需要为最终报告添加自己元数据。这个库高级用法来了。您可以通过更改默认配置控制报告各个方面。...你可以通过使用相关性配置简单地禁用其他系数。

    3.2K10

    【云+社区年度征文】云直播:基于API+SCF+Redis实现流状态同步和查询

    模版名称按需填写:测试回调模版 回调密钥请填写随机字符串:593a4fcbd02c36c515d712557c120ba8 推流回调和断流回调填写刚刚拼接回调地址:https://service-xx...2、选择刚刚创建函数livecb,点击函数名进入后,切换到函数配置选项卡,点击右侧编辑按钮; 3、在环境变量中,添加如下变量,然后点击保存 redisHost:172.16.0.44 #此处填写步骤...5、下载代码附件到本地 阶段一代码.zip 6、切换到函数代码选项卡,选择提交方法为“本地上传zip包”,选择刚刚下载附件,然后点击保存按钮。...2、选择刚刚创建函数livestat,点击函数名进入后,切换到函数配置选项卡,点击右侧编辑按钮; 3、勾选运行角色,选择刚刚创建角色scf-livestat image.png 4、在环境变量中,...自此,阶段二已经实现,可以通过云API网关所允许方式发起HTTP请求验证 本文中API网关 livestat只勾选了内网访问,未开放外网调用 登录同一个子网一台CVM,通过curl测试可验证服务可用性

    2.7K92

    Python 自动化指南(繁琐工作自动化)第二版:十八、发送电子邮件和短信

    一旦您有了电子邮件运营商域名和端口信息,通过调用smptlib.SMTP()创建一个SMTP对象,将域名作为字符串参数传递,将端口作为整数参数传递。...对于所有拖欠会费会员,通过调用sendmail()方法发送个性化提醒电子邮件。 打开一个新文件编辑器选项卡,并将其另存为sendDuesReminders.py。...smtplib.SMTP()并向传递运营商域名和端口创建一个SMTP对象。...分别在myTwilioNumber和myCellPhone中存储您 Twilio 号码和手机号码后,调用create()并向传递指定文本消息正文、发送者号码(myTwilioNumber)和接收者号码...举个简单例子,这里有一个带有textmyself()函数小 Python 程序,它发送一条作为字符串参数传递给它消息。

    11.2K40

    tf.summary

    但是,TensorFlow中最重要可视化方法是通过TensorBoard、tf.summary和tf.summary.FileWriter这三个模块相互合作完成。...如果你将图形传递给构造函数,它将被添加到事件文件中。(这相当于稍后调用add_graph())。...此方法将提供摘要封装在事件协议缓冲区中,并将其添加到事件文件中。你可以使用tf.Session.run或tf.张量传递计算任何总结op结果。对这个函数求eval。...family: 可选;如果提供,用作摘要标记名称前缀,它控制用于在Tensorboard上显示选项卡名称。返回值:字符串类型标量张量。序列化摘要协议缓冲区。...family: 可选;如果提供,用作摘要标记名称前缀,它控制用于在Tensorboard上显示选项卡名称。返回值:字符串类型标量张量。序列化摘要协议缓冲区。

    2.5K61

    43道JavaScript面试题

    对于箭头函数,this关键字指向是它所在上下文(定义时位置)环境,与普通函数不同! 这意味着当我们调用perimeter时,它不是指向shape对象,而是指定义时环境(window)。...静态方法仅在创建它们构造函数中存在,并且不能传递给任何子级。 由于freddie是一个子级对象,函数不会传递,所以在freddie实例上不存在freddie方法:抛出TypeError。...您自己编写代码并不是实际函数。 该函数是具有属性对象,此属性是可调用。 ---- 11. 下面代码输出是什么?...其余参数获取传递到模板字符串表达式值! ---- 17. 下面代码输出是什么?...B:用户关闭选项卡时。 C:当用户关闭整个浏览器时,不仅是选项卡。 D:用户关闭计算机时。 答案: B 关闭选项卡后,将删除存储在sessionStorage中数据。

    1.8K20

    配电网WebGIS研究与开发

    所有的Web ADF controls都具有CallbackResults属性,通过CallbackResultsCollection可以添加、删除这些CallbackResults,或者将其转换为字符串显示...比如,地图范围改变或者地图比例变化都会引起Map控件自动更新callback result collection。其他情况,如更改地图可见性或者添加删除某个地图资源都需要明确调用刷新方法。...ADF数据接口和函数接口供调用,开发人员可以通过编写服务器端和客户端代码实现相关功能(主要功能和框架模板已经给出),在客户端只需要在页面文件前面加入对此名空间引用声明即可使用此控件:...+ geom.get_y();//编码 …… this.doCallback(argument,this);//执行回调――向服务器端发送数据 ……   客户端对地图坐标值进行编码后,然后再将编码字符串通过异步方式传递给服务器...artDialog只需要传递一个div层数据,然后调用JS函数打开对话框,就可以在客户端将指定div里面的内容显示出来。

    1.2K20

    如何实现前端新手引导功能?

    我持续组织了近一年源码共读活动,感兴趣可以 点此扫码加我微信 lxchuan12 参与,每周大家一起学习200行左右源码,共同进步。...调用以下 JavaScript 函数: introJs().start(); 可以使用以下附加参数在特定元素或类上调用 Intro.js: introJs(".introduction-farm")....具有以下特点: 易于使用 高度可定制 文档完善 积极维护 可以使用以下命令来安装 react-joyride: npm i react-joyride 可以通过以下方式在 React 中使用 react-joyride...$mount('#app') 最后将 v-tour 组件放入模板中任何位置(通常在 App.vue 中),并向传递一系列步骤。...可以通过以下命令来安装 reactour: npm i -S @reactour/tour 安装完成之后,在应用根组件添加 TourProvider,传递元素步骤以在浏览期间突出显示: import

    3K60

    nodejs 写 bash 脚本终极方案!

    exec:启动一个子进程执行命令,与spawn不同是,它有一个回调函数能知道子进程情况 execFile:启动一子进程执行可执行文件 fork:与spawn类似,不同点是它需要指定子进程需要需执行...$`command` 使用 child_process 包中 spawn 函数执行给定字符串, 并返回 ProcessPromise. let count = parseInt(await $`ls...zx提供了 require() 函数,因此它可以与 .mjs 文件中导入一起使用(当使用 zx 可执行文件时) 传递环境变量 process.env.FOO = 'bar' await $`echo...$FOO` 复制代码 传递数组 如果值数组作为参数传递给 $,数组项目将被单独转义并通过空格连接 Example: let files = [1,2,3] await $`tar cz ${files...}` 复制代码 可以通过显式导入来使用 $ 和其他函数 #!

    2.5K20

    今天教你!

    组件 props 中解构了 title 和 onClick。在这里,title 是一个文本字符串,onClick 是一个在单击按钮时调用函数。...让我们继续编写函数,该函数将使用 setOpenedEditor 更改单击选项卡按钮时 state 值。 注意:这里可能不会同时打开两个选项卡,所以我们在编写函数时需要考虑到这一点。...注意:因为编辑器是作为可重用组件构建,所以我们不能在编辑器中直接把模式写死。所以,我们通过我们解构 language 提供模式。...接下来,我们讨论一下 ControlledEditorComponent 中东西: onBeforeChange 每当你向编辑器写入或从编辑器中删除时,都会调用此方法。...你可能希望编辑器占用比我们这里更多屏幕空间。你可以尝试另一件事是通过单击停靠在侧面某处按钮弹出 iframe。这样做会给编辑器更多屏幕空间。

    12K30

    【实战】快来和我一起开发一个在线 Web 代码编辑器

    组件 props 中解构了 title 和 onClick。 在这里,title 是一个文本字符串,onClick 是一个在单击按钮时调用函数。...让我们继续编写函数,该函数将使用 setOpenedEditor 更改单击选项卡按钮时 state 值。 注意:这里可能不会同时打开两个选项卡,所以我们在编写函数时需要考虑到这一点。...注意:因为编辑器是作为可重用组件构建,所以我们不能在编辑器中直接把模式写死。 所以,我们通过我们解构 language 提供模式。...接下来,我们讨论一下 ControlledEditorComponent 中东西: onBeforeChange 每当你向编辑器写入或从编辑器中删除时,都会调用此方法。...你可能希望编辑器占用比我们这里更多屏幕空间。 你可以尝试另一件事是通过单击停靠在侧面某处按钮弹出 iframe。 这样做会给编辑器更多屏幕空间。

    73320

    如何在 React 应用中使用 Hooks、Redux 等管理状态

    最后,如上所述,每次我们想要更新状态时,都必须使用我们声明函数:setCount,只需要调用它并将我们想要新状态作为参数传递给它。...const [state, dispatch] = useReducer(reducer, { count: 0 }) 最后,我们不会直接调用 reducer 去更新状态,而是调用我们刚刚创建函数...总结一下,我们只需要: 一个 reducer,合并所有可能状态变化函数 一个 dispatch 函数,将修改动作传递给 reducer 这里问题是, UI 元素将不能像以前那样通过用一个值调用 setState...在代码中,你可以看到,对于每个 action,我们都声明了常量代替普通字符串(这是一个可以提高可维护性好做法),以及一些仅返回一个 type 或者 一个 type 和一个 payload 函数。...npm install @reduxjs/toolkit react-redux 来安装它 在我们 store 中,我们从 Redux toolkit 中导入 configureStore 函数通过调用函数来创建

    8.5K20

    Python让Excel飞起来:使用Python xlwings实现Excel自动化

    2.使用Python编写宏,并通过单击按钮从Excel运行。 3.使用Python编写用户定义函数,并像调用任何Excel内置函数一样从Excel中调用这些函数。 听起来很刺激?让我们开始吧!...然而,它需要一点VBA允许Excel调用Python函数。 Python脚本 让我们首先编写一个简单Python函数,该函数生成10个随机数,然后将它们放在Excel工作表单元格A1中。...第四部分:在Python中编写用户定义函数并在Excel中调用函数 高级Excel用户都知道,我们可以在VBA中创建用户定义函数。这项功能很棒,因为并非所有内置Excel函数都适合我们需要。...必须将其添加到def之前,以让xlwings知道这是一个用户定义函数。 该函数必须返回某些内容,以便将返回传递到Excel中。...我们似乎在使用Excel函数,但其实在后台,Python正在进行所有计算,然后通过Excel向用户显示结果。这意味着,由于Python强大功能,我们可以创建非常复杂函数

    9.3K41
    领券